自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(48)
  • 收藏
  • 关注

转载 C++联合体(union)

C++的union本质上也是个类,跟struct性质几乎一致但是有一个最大的区别,数据共享内存说到共享内存就要说下union的内存分配union的大小是按照union里面的成员内存的最大值而分配的,函数不占内存,但是如果没有成员或者成员都是函数时,内存分配为1,占位,表明存在。转载于:https://www.cnblogs.com/yangrlee/p/5170206.html...

2016-01-29 22:10:00 49

转载 并发操作的一致性问题

2.2.1 并发一致性问题常见并发并发一致性问题包括:丢失的修改、不可重复读、读脏数据、幻影读(幻影读在一些资料中往往与不可重复读归为一类)。2.2.1.1 丢失修改下面我们先来看一个例子,说明并发操作带来的数据的不一致性问题。考虑飞机订票系统中的一个活动序列:甲售票点(甲事务)读出某航班的机票余额A,设A=16.乙售票点(乙事务)读出同一航班的机票余额A,也...

2016-01-29 21:23:00 208

转载 【bzoj】1026: [SCOI2009]windy数

1026: [SCOI2009]windy数Descriptionwindy定义了一种windy数。不含前导零且相邻两个数字之差至少为2的正整数被称为windy数。 windy想知道,在A和B之间,包括A和B,总共有多少个windy数?100%的数据,满足 1 <= A <= B <= 2000000000思路:和 不要62以及Bomb差不多一样,有一点需要注...

2016-01-29 10:31:00 117

转载 Android WebView loadData读取两次才能显示的问题

webview.loadDataWithBaseURL(null,result,"text/html", "utf-8", null);使用loadDataWithBaseURL替代loadData参考网址:http://stackoverflow.com/questions/17501860/had-to-load-data-twice-to-make-webview-refre...

2016-01-27 22:23:00 120

转载 将Mininet与真实网络相连接

原文发表在我的博客主页,转载请注明出处前言Mininet是SDN网络仿真的一大利器,在小规模网络模拟使用上独领风骚,其开源性允许使用者按照自己的需求修改源码,得到想要的数据,其提供了多个函数用来满足用户的需求,十分方便。OpenvSwitch(OVS)是一个基于Linux内核的虚拟交换机,可以取代Linux网络协议栈,并且效果十分好,OVS的应用十分广泛,在云计算和SDN网络虚拟化中都有重要...

2016-01-26 22:35:00 505

转载 学习笔记1 2016/1/26 how to use git(1)

How to use git:1.commit 当发生logical change的时候,无论是修改还是添加新代码2.git log 查看该repo内的commit git log --stat 给出数据统计 xx changed......3.git diff commitB commitA 给出A相对于B的变化4.git checkout "commit...

2016-01-26 21:36:00 42

转载 Oracle Enterprise Manager Cloud Control 12c R4 安装配置

准备软件em12.1.0.4_linux64_V45344-01.zipem12.1.0.4_linux64_V45345-01.zipem12.1.0.4_linux64_V45346-01.zip安装操作系统(OEL6.5)给 OS 空间 50G 以上装完OS和CC后须要占用 30G 空间建议6G 内存最少4G[oracle@ newcc ...

2016-01-26 15:12:00 82

转载 2016.01.22 单例模式(Singleton)

单例模式:整个程序的一个类只能有一个实例对象:(UIApplication、NSUserDefaults等都是IOS中的系统单例)        1.物理设备  eg:打印机        2.不可多个同时存在的资源  eg:数据库单例的写法:  这是第一种,也是最简单、最常用的一种: 1 #import "FileOpration.h" 2 3 static F...

2016-01-25 18:29:00 39

转载 PHP常用表达式用法

PHP常用表达式用法1.匹配正整数:/^[1-9]\d*$/2.匹配非负整数(正整数+0):/^\d+$/3.匹配中文:/^[\x{4e00}-\x{9fa5}]+$/u4.匹配Email:/^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*/5.匹配网址URL:(((f|ht){1}(tp|tps)://)[-a-zA-Z0-9@:%_\...

2016-01-25 16:00:00 91

转载 ios应用间跳转

有时候,需要在本应用中打开其他应用,比如从A应用中跳转到B应用首先,B应用得有自己的URL地址(在Info.plist中配置)B应用的URL地址就是:mj://ios.itcast.cn  接着在A应用中使用UIApplication完成跳转  NSURL *url = [NSURL URLWithString:@"mj://ios.itcast.cn"];...

2016-01-25 14:28:00 39

转载 GTK不规则窗体

GTK不规则窗体示例GdkBitmap *window_shape_bitmap = gdk_pixmap_new(NULL, m_ROI.width + 2, m_ROI.height + 2, 1);GdkGC *gc = gdk_gc_new(window_shape_bitmap);GdkColormap *colorMap = gdk_colormap_get_...

2016-01-24 21:17:00 84

转载 小睡一下做了个梦

昨晚睡得晚了点,早上醒得早,刚才很困就睡着了, 做了个梦。前面的剧情有点不记得了,又是飞船又是任务的。梦见两个人在弄一个什么机器,好像是为了帮另一个人利用引力弹弓发射私人宇宙飞船,然后门外一个小女孩在使用传送装置,但是好像出了什么问题不能设定坐标,她看到那两个人就比划着问能不能帮帮她,其中一个人想出去看看但另一个人不让。然后机器运行最后阶段发出了很大的电磁干扰,警察来了,把两个人带走了。这...

2016-01-24 12:29:00 55

转载 比较两个数字是否相等 杭电2054

Give you two numbers A and B, if A is equal to B, you should print "YES", or print "NO".Inputeach test case contains two numbers A and B.Outputfor each case, if A is equal to B, yo...

2016-01-22 18:56:00 222

转载 day12

Python操作 RabbitMQ、Redis、Memcache、SQLAlchemy一。memcachedMemcached 是一个高性能的分布式内存对象缓存系统,用于动态Web应用以减轻数据库负载。它通过在内存中缓存数据和对象来减少读取数据库的次数,从而提高动态、数据库驱动网站的速度。Memcached基于一个存储键/值对的hashmap。其守护进程(daemon )是用C写的,但是客...

2016-01-22 18:12:00 42

转载 CSS注意事项

1.定义样式不能就加;隔开当有定义的css样式并没有起作用的时候看看定义该样式前边有没有加“;”的如 p{};div{}转载于:https://www.cnblogs.com/ITCoNan/p/5148084.html...

2016-01-21 14:08:00 32

转载 C#序列化

引言:可远程处理和不可远程处理的对象请记住,在一个应用程序域中创建并因而特定于该域的对象可以直接从该域中调用,但如果要从该域中调用在其他域中创建的对象,就必须先进行一些设置,这一点非常重要。并非所有类型的对象都可以跨域边界进行有效地发布和使用;因此,必须根据应用程序的要求来决定要发布哪种对象。为了开发分布式应用程序,有两类对象可供选择:不可远程处理的对象和可远程处理的对象。不可远程处理的对...

2016-01-21 10:05:00 33

转载 真机测试最详细的步骤

参考:http://blog.csdn.net/crazyzhang1990/article/details/46449503 真机测试http://blog.csdn.net/yczz/article/details/22962433 真机测试 这两个网址是介绍的比较详细的转载于:https://www.cnblogs.com/lishanshan/p/5147189.html...

2016-01-21 09:10:00 26

转载 走近青瓷引擎(海外用户评测报告)

近日在海外社交新闻站点Reddit上对青瓷引擎展开了激烈的讨论,起因是海外一个专门介绍各类游戏引擎的网站GameFromScratch发表了一篇名为《走进青瓷引擎》的新手教程和评测。今天将带大家一起来看看这篇文章。(文章为全英文,为了方便大家阅读,对每段大意做了简单翻译。若有任何疑问欢迎交流。)Welcome to another episode in the “Closer Look ...

2016-01-20 13:37:00 92

转载 SurfaceView

1.概念 SurfaceView是View类的子类,可以直接从内存或者DMA等硬件接口取得图像数据,是个非常重要的绘图视图。它的特性是:可以在主线程之外的线程中向屏幕绘图上。这样可以避免画图任务繁重的时候造成主线程阻塞,从而提高了程序的反应速度。在游戏开发中多用到SurfaceView,游戏中的背景、人物、动画等等尽量在画布canvas中画出。2.实现方法1)实现步骤...

2016-01-20 09:57:00 41

转载 环形缓冲区的设计及其在生产者消费者模式下的使用(并发有锁环形队列)

1、环形缓冲区缓冲区的好处,就是空间换时间和协调快慢线程。缓冲区可以用很多设计法,这里说一下环形缓冲区的几种设计方案,可以看成是几种环形缓冲区的模式。设计环形缓冲区涉及到几个点,一是超出缓冲区大小的的索引如何处理,二是如何表示缓冲区满和缓冲区空,三是如何入队、出队,四是缓冲区中数据长度如何计算。ps.规定以下所有方案,在缓冲区满时不可再写入数据,缓冲区空时不能读数据1.1、常规数组环形...

2016-01-19 17:22:00 423

转载 类似心电图效果的程序

c#做一个类似心电图效果的程序,从左往右100ms描一个点,连线,就像用笔在画线一样,到达一定宽度,再从头画,这时每描一个点,就先擦出这一列的点。http://files.cnblogs.com/files/root_u/delll.7z转载于:https://www.cnblogs.com/root_u/p/5141548.html...

2016-01-19 11:04:00 171

转载 ArcGIS4Android 2:多个安卓module共享jar和so文件

初学java和安卓,简单的学习历程记录,勿喷。android studio一个project下有多个module共享jar和so文件的解决方案,解决重复问题。1.多处重复引用libs和so文件问题android studio一个project下有多个module的情况,以前引用共同的jar包和so文件,是每个module下复制一份。结果这样重复文件太多了,而且体积很大。...

2016-01-18 22:51:00 33

转载 分页Bootstrap实现

<%@ include file="/init.jsp" %> <script type="text/javascript" src="jquery-1.12.0.min.js"></script> <script type="text/javascript" src="jquery-ui.min-1.11.4.js"&...

2016-01-18 10:38:00 43

转载 调用jacob服务时注意事项

需求有一个将office文件转成PDF并添加水印的功能,office转PDF需要用到jacob功能转化代码 private static final int wdFormatPDF = 17; private static final int xlTypePDF = 0; private static final int ppSaveAsPDF = 32; ...

2016-01-18 09:53:00 348

转载 swift-var/let定义变量和常量

// Playground - noun: a place where people can playimport UIKit//------------------------------------------------------------------------------// 1. 行打印一个字符串println("Hello, World!")//-----...

2016-01-17 21:23:00 44

转载 学习笔记 --- 最小费用最大流

最小费用最大流,本人一只三种算法,MCMF、zkw(张昆玮)、Primal-Daul。然而基本没见人用过PD,多数都是MCMF和zkw。 对比起来,MCMF是基于spfa的一种算法,在稀疏图上十分高效;zkw算法是用spfa和KM重标号来进行计算的,在稠密图很高效,不过有一种图能够使zkw变慢:费用不小,容量不大,增广路比较长;zkw最小费用最大流:bool sp...

2016-01-17 18:51:00 368

转载 PHP - 防止 XSS(跨站脚本攻击)

<?PHP/*** @blog http://www.phpddt.com* @param $string* @param $low 安全别级低*/function clean_xss(&$string, $low = False){ if (! is_array ( $string )) { $string = tri...

2016-01-17 18:07:00 174

转载 ASP.NET MVC5 route使用

http://blog.csdn.net/cauchy8389/article/details/22937189转载于:https://www.cnblogs.com/terryc/p/5135389.html

2016-01-16 13:46:00 85

转载 java 构造方法不能用void 来修饰

java 构造方法类的构造方法在类中除了成员方法之外,还存在一种特殊类型的方法,就是构造方法。构造方法是一个与类名同名的方法,对象的创造就是通过构造方法完成的,每当类实例化一个对象时,类就会自动调用构造方法。构造方法有如下特点名字与类名一致没有任何返回类型 即使是void空返回也不行构造方法的名称要与本类的名称相同注意在定义构造方法...

2016-01-15 19:43:00 1191

转载 Android 设置背景透明度

一些时候,我们需要为UI页面设置背景色,如下图所示: 上图已注: 背景颜色为#000000,透明度为40%; 那么,如何在代码中表示呢? 首先需要了解: 颜色和不透明度 (alpha) 值以十六进制表示法表示。任何一种颜色的值范围都是 0 到 255(00 到 ff)。对于 alpha,00 表示完全透明,ff 表示完全不透明。表达式顺序是“aabbggrr”,其中aa...

2016-01-14 23:18:00 35

转载 增加响应header让ajax支持跨域

ajax请求数据步骤发送请求--->浏览器接受响应--->判断是否是同域下是的话,就把响应数据返回给ajax。不是的话就提醒禁止跨域请求。现在可以在响应头重增加header("Access-Control-Allow-Origin: http://localhost");header("Access-Control-Allow-Methods: POST, G...

2016-01-13 19:12:00 447

转载 python set集合操作

set集合是一个无序且不重复的集合。创建一个set集合:name = set('sdd')name返回结果:{'d', 's'}add 功能:增加集合元素 name = {'d', 's'} name.add('d') name 返回结果:{'d', 's'} name.add('sd') name 返回结果:{'sd', ...

2016-01-13 18:03:00 32

转载 JavaScript HashTable

function HashTable() { var loseHashCode = function(key) { var hash = 0; for (var i = 0; i < key.length; i++) { hash += key.charCodeAt(i) } return hash % 37 } var table = [];...

2016-01-11 22:10:00 32

转载 检测windows计算机的硬件

自己造了个轮子,用python+wmic去获取windows的硬件信息,其实是很狭隘的版本。之前写过一个版本,用requests+json去网上获取,但是那个有个坑,联想的序列号分不清带不带I,如x230和x230i序列号可能是一样的,还得选。所以只好自己写了。# coding=GBKimport os,re# windows计算机硬件检查的函数def wm...

2016-01-11 15:46:00 104

转载 Struts2整理-----Struts2入门

Struts2简介struts2是在webwork2基础上发展而来的。和struts1一样,struts2也属于MVC框架。不过有一点需要注意的是:struts2和struts2虽然名字很相似,但是在两者在代码编写风格上几乎是不一样的。那么既然有了struts1,为什么还要推出struts2。主要的原因是struts2有以下优点:1.在软件设计上struts2不依赖于ser...

2016-01-08 17:08:00 50

转载 查询语句

1.select count(*) 2.select count(1)1.2.返回结果都 一样,表没有主键,count(1)比count(*)快,但如果表只有一个字段,count(*)最快。它们包括对null 的统计。如果有主键,count(主键)最快。count(column)不包括对null 的统计。3.select 14.select *select 常量 只返回一个常量。返回所有的行,值...

2016-01-08 16:47:00 32

转载 Nginx的accept_mutex配置分析

让我们看看accept_mutex的意义:当一个新连接到达时,如果激活了accept_mutex,那么多个Worker将以串行方式来处理,其中有一个Worker会被唤醒,其他的Worker继续保持休眠状态;如果没有激活accept_mutex,那么所有的Worker都会被唤醒,不过只有一个Worker能获取新连接,其它的Worker会重新进入休眠状态,这就是「惊群问题」。Nginx缺...

2016-01-08 11:25:00 420

转载 maven常用命令

Maven库:http://repo2.maven.org/maven2/Maven依赖查询:http://mvnrepository.com/Maven常用命令:1. 创建Maven的普通java项目: mvn archetype:create -DgroupId=packageName -DartifactId=projectName2. 创建Maven...

2016-01-08 09:58:00 25

转载 软件测试工程师面试题

01.您认为做好测试用例设计工作的关键是什么?对需求能够深入了解,了解提出该需求的原因以及业务背景,掌握需求的来龙去脉,获取更多更详细的需求,如功能、非功能等。以及软件设计概要文档,了解程序的架构和数据流转等,这样测试用例设计才能够覆盖更全,才能够设计出针对性的测试用例  一般来说,设计一个比较实用的测试用例,注意如下几个方面:  a. 选用好的用例管理工具(这个很重要,千万不要用wo...

2016-01-08 08:43:00 76

转载 java中的Runable和Thread

在java中可有两种方式实现多线程,一种是继承Thread类,一种是实现Runnable接口;Thread类是在java.lang包中定义的。一个类只要继承了Thread类同时覆写了本类中的run()方法就可以实现多线程操作了,但是一个类只能继承一个父类,这是此方法的局限。AD: 51CTO 网+首届APP创新评选大赛火热启动——超百万资源等你拿!在ja...

2016-01-06 21:17:00 28

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除